Types of Solar Panel Batteries
There are primarily three types of batteries used with solar panel systems: lead-acid, lithium-ion, and saltwater batteries. Each type comes with its own set of characteristics, advantages, and drawbacks.
Lead-Acid Batteries
Lead-acid batteries have been historically used in renewable energy systems. They are reliable and cost-effective but have a shorter lifespan and lower depth of discharge compared to newer technologies. This means they may not utilize the full capacity of the stored energy effectively.
Lithium-Ion Batteries
Lithium-ion batteries are becoming increasingly popular for solar panel battery for home systems due to their longevity, efficiency, and compact design. They have a higher depth of discharge and a lifespan that can exceed 10 years, which translates into better overall investment for homeowners.
Saltwater Batteries
Saltwater batteries represent a developing technology that uses non-toxic materials. While they are still in the early stages of adoption, they provide a safe alternative for energy storage, although they currently have lower energy density compared to lithium-ion solutions.
Benefits of Using a Solar Panel Battery for Home
Utilizing a solar panel battery for home systems offers several advantages. One of the key benefits is energy independence, which allows homeowners to reduce their reliance on the grid and protect themselves from fluctuating electricity prices.
Cost Savings
By storing excess energy produced during sunny days, homeowners can use battery-stored energy during peak usage times when electricity rates are usually higher. This can lead to significant savings on energy bills over time.

Backup Power
A solar panel battery for home use can also provide backup power during outages, ensuring that essential appliances and devices remain operational. This added layer of security is particularly valuable in areas prone to severe weather or power interruptions.
Choosing the Right Solar Panel Battery
When selecting a solar panel battery for home use, consider factors such as capacity, discharge rate, and warranty. Understanding your household energy consumption can help determine the appropriate battery size and type for your specific needs.
Capacity and Power Needs
The capacity of a battery is measured in kilowatt-hours (kWh), which indicates how much energy it can store. Assessing your daily energy consumption can help you choose the right capacity that aligns with your lifestyle and energy needs.
Efficiency Ratings
Different batteries have varying efficiency ratings that affect how much energy can be effectively used. Look for batteries with higher round-trip efficiencies to get the most out of your solar energy investment.
Installation and Maintenance
Proper installation of a solar panel battery for home systems is crucial for optimal performance. It's advisable to work with a certified installer who can ensure that your system is safely integrated with your existing solar panels.
Maintenance Tips
Regular maintenance can extend the life of your solar battery. Monitor state-of-charge and discharge cycles, keep the area around the battery clean, and check for any signs of wear or corrosion.
